Output 843187034a06ec3758a311c55ac7d0f0382768714e4d1d6bc08a8e6a2c2e2bbe:0

value
66618
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 187f892fa4024d4d27bce94c9280666a9ad5c91e OP_EQUALVERIFY OP_CHECKSIG
address
13EXzxF2EcmfWxpSgUgJbnBR97jKm7H54S
transaction
843187034a06ec3758a311c55ac7d0f0382768714e4d1d6bc08a8e6a2c2e2bbe
confirmations
170561
spent
true